Highlights
Are people in Vancouver older or younger than people in Alliance?
- The Median Age in Vancouver is 1.4 years older than in Alliance.

Are housing costs cheaper in Vancouver or Alliance?
- Vancouver housing costs are 253.0% more expensive than Alliance hous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Vancouver or Alliance?
- The average commute for residents of Vancouver is 5.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Alliance.

Things to do in Vancouver?
Vancouver, Washington is a beautiful and diverse city with plenty of activities to explore. Nature lovers can check out the stunning views of the Columbia River Gorge or admire the wildlife at nearby Ridgefield National Wildlife Refuge. Visitors also have plenty of shopping and dining options, as well as historic sites like the Pearson Air Museum or Fort Vancouver National Historic Site. From its amazing art galleries and museums to its lively downtown, Vancouver offers something for everyone - making it an unforgettable destination!
